The CURT 13409 Class 3 Trailer Hitch is a rugged, custom-fit towing solution designed specifically for select Subaru Forester models. Rated for 3,500 lbs gross trailer weight and 525 lbs tongue weight, it features a durable dual-coat finish that resists rust, chipping, and UV damage. Tested to SAE J684 standards, this 2-inch receiver hitch ensures reliable, safe towing with easy installation supported by detailed guides and innovative design features.

A**E
Solid hitch, excellent craftsmanship.
Installed this hitch on my 2023 Subaru Forester with no issues. I don’t suggest someone with little mechanical capabilities attempt it, at least without expecting some serious effort or an experienced assistant. I recall an estimate of one hour for the installation, but being experienced at this type of this work , it took me 1.5 hours. The fit was great as were the instructions. Two tough steps were #1) enlarging two mounting holes from 1/2” to 1-1/8” dia. and # 2) lifting the hitch into place. On the #2 challenge I set up a jack to do the lifting and holding. Everything I need was included and the quality was great. I highly recommended this hitch.

B**S
Good, solid, mostly hidden hitch.
This is a good well built hitch that is mostly hidden once installed. The installation was a bit time consuming and requires some tooling. Removing the muffler is easier than just lowering it, supporting the exhaust and working around it(which is what the directions say). The directions also tell you to use a die grinder to enlarge the holes in the frame. While I have done that in the past a step drill that drills to 1 1/8 inch is much easier, and I suggest painting the bare metal after enlarging the holes to prevent rust;I waited overnight for the paint to dry. The directions state that the hitch covers the rear muffler heat shield bolt and it does but it is still very rigid when mounted. The hitch also covered the forward screw for the drivers underbody panel on my 2024 Forester. I would have drilled an access hole thru the hitch mount if I noticed this before tightening it down. This hitch rated for 3500 lbs and my Forester only tows 1500 so a small hole is no big deal in my opinion. Ultimately I drilled a small hole and used a sheetmetal screw for a replacement fastening point.
